Manhattan Unfurled Book by Matteo Pericoli
Located in North Hollywood, CA
Manhattan Unfurled by Pericoli, Matteo and Goldberger, Paul   Matteo Pericoli trained as an architect in Milan and then came to work in New York in 1995. His arrival preceded by just a few days the arrival of the biggest snowstorm of the decade, and the sense of the city in its wake–especially its silence–remained in his mind. He experienced similar feeling taking photographs of Riverside Drive from the Circle Line ferry, and decided to transpose them into a line drawing. It was then that he felt compelled to photograph the whole of New York’s shoreline profile–from Queens, Brooklyn, the Bronx, and New Jersey (which he reached by motorcycle) — and make two continuous and continuously enchanting pen-and-ink drawing of Manhattan’s skyline.   Manhattan Unfurled is published in an elegant slipcase, and the drawings fold out, accordion-style, with the West on one side and the East on the other. An introduction by distinguished New Yorker architecture critic Paul Goldberger, who first wrote bout Matteo’s project in The New Yorker’s “Talk of the Town,” will accompany the drawing in a separate pamphlet. Modern Times, The Age of Photography by Mattie Boom, 1st Ed
Located in valatie, NY
Modern Times - The Age of Photography by Mattie Boom. Published by Rijksmuseum Amsterdam, 2014. 1st Ed hardcover. The Rijksmuseum's Philips Wing is scheduled to reopen in November 2014 with Modern Times: The Age of Photography, a major survey of twentieth-century photography culled from the Rijksmuseum's collection (a first for the museum). Growing spectacularly since the decision was made in 1994 to collect photography beyond the nineteenth century, the collection now includes some 20,000 twentieth-century works, including masterpieces by photographers such as Andre Kertesz, Brassai, Robert Capa, Laszlo Moholy-Nagy, Henri Cartier-Bresson, Weegee, William Klein, Eva Besnyo, Man Ray and Joel Meyerowitz. Fred Herzog, Vancouver Photographs by Fred Herzog, Signed Edition
Located in valatie, NY
Fred Herzog: Vancouver Photographs by Fred Herzog. Signed Edition exhibition catalog (Vancouver Art Gallery January 25-May 13, 2007). 160 pages with numerous color photographs throughout. "Iconic and influential color images of Vancouver street life from a master photographer who has spent the past fifty years documenting the city, published to coincide with a major exhibition of his work. His eye dwells on the raw urban underbelly of the city: second-hand shops, vacant lots, barber shops and greasy spoons, crowded with people and their stuttering dreams. Since he arrived in Vancouver from Germany in 1953, Fred Herzog has roamed the city's back streets with his camera. Herzog draws upon documentary traditions while incorporating an outsider's sensitivity to a new environment. The Gernsheim Collection, Edited by Roy Flukinger, 1st Ed
Located in valatie, NY
The Gernsheim Collection, Edited by Roy Flukinger. University of Texas Press, Sep 1, 2010. One of the most important collections of photography in the world. Amassed by the renowned husband-and-wife team of Helmut and Alison Gernsheim between 1945 and 1963, it contains an unparalleled range of images, beginning with the world's earliest-known photograph from nature, made by Joseph Nicéphore Niépce in 1826. It includes some 35,000 major and representative photographs from the 19th and 20th c; a research library of some 3,600 books, journals, and published articles; about 250 autographed letters and manuscripts; and more than 200 pieces of early photographic equipment. Its encyclopedic scope—as well as the expertise and taste with which the Gernsheims built the collection—makes the Gernsheim Collection one of the world's premier resources for the study and appreciation of the development of photography. Published to coincide with a landmark exhibition staged by the Harry Ransom Center at the University of Texas at Austin, which owns the collection, this book presents masterpieces of the collection, along with lesser-known images of great historical significance. Arranged in chronological order, this selection effectively constitutes a visual history of photography from its beginnings to the mid-20th c. Each full-page image is accompanied by an extensive annotation in which Roy Flukinger describes the photograph's place in the evolution of photography and also within the Gernsheim Collection. Flukinger also provides an enlightening introduction in which he traces the Gernsheims' passionate careers as collectors and pioneering historians of photography, showing how their untiring efforts significantly contributed to the acceptance of photography as a fine art and as a field worthy of intellectual inquiry.
